Output 637f7ae9116ff50cfc2d7466bc5b0c2a62bcbf00e07d248c25f65463ae9df115:5

value
21878200
script pubkey
OP_0 OP_PUSHBYTES_20 da5dd78f8cdb04475bf4299687f37020f2120930
address
bc1qmfwa0ruvmvzywkl59xtg0umsyrepyzfssyzf30
transaction
637f7ae9116ff50cfc2d7466bc5b0c2a62bcbf00e07d248c25f65463ae9df115
spent
true